Discover How Breaking Bread Builds Community in Bountiful

Breaking Bread Community Dinners: close-up of freshly baked loaves

Breaking Bread: A Tradition of Unity in Bountiful

For nearly 16 years, the community of Bountiful has come together in a simple yet powerful way—by sharing meals across diverse backgrounds. On the third Wednesday of each month, a robust crowd gathers to partake in a collective feast, created not just for nourishment, but as a means to bridge different religions and cultures. This initiative exemplifies the heart of community and the beauty of shared experiences.

In 'Sunday Edition: Breaking bread, building community,' the video highlights how food unites divergent backgrounds in Bountiful, inviting us to reflect on the significance of these gatherings.

A Celebration of Togetherness

Recently, Bountiful celebrated an impressive milestone: their 150th communal meal themed 'Italian Night'. With 190 attendees and an impressive surplus of food that fed an additional 80 people, organizers emphasize creating an open invitation for all. Vicar Shannon Burke from the Episcopal Church of the Resurrection notes that these meals help forge deeper relationships among participants, encouraging attendance at church services and engaging individuals in fellowship.

The Power of Food in Fostering Community Bonds

Participants echo thoughts on the importance of these gatherings, noting how sharing a meal lets down walls and cultivates camaraderie. "It's amazing how food can connect us. We all share the same needs and desires, and breaking bread is a symbol of peace and unity," says one local diner. Serving meals on real plates with silverware enhances the experience further, elevating a simple dinner into a cherished tradition steeped in care and consideration.

Understanding Bison Behavior: Safety Lessons from Yellowstone's Wildlife Encounters

Update The Surprising Dynamics of Wildlife Encounters When we think of encounters with wildlife, especially in national parks like Yellowstone, it's easy to imagine serene moments of connection with nature. However, as seen in the recent bison attack, these interactions can quickly turn dangerous. Tragically, incidents like this one highlight the need for understanding and respecting the natural behaviors of animals. Why Respecting Wildlife is Crucial According to wildlife experts, bison are not inherently aggressive but will defend themselves if they feel threatened. During busy tourist seasons, misunderstandings can arise, particularly when visitors venture too close to these majestic animals. This incident serves as a crucial reminder that maintaining a safe distance is essential for both human safety and animal well-being. Insights from Local Experts Local Utah wildlife specialist emphasizes the importance of education about bison behavior. He notes that many tourists may not realize how quickly a seemingly calm animal can react defensively. Fielding educational outreach is key—community members and park visitors alike must understand how to responsibly enjoy wildlife experiences.
